# §9811. Limitation on assistance


No financial assistance shall be provided under this part unless the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2) determines that—

- (1) any cooperative association receiving assistance has a minimum of fifteen active members, a majority of which are low-income rural persons;
- (2) adequate technical assistance is made available and committed to the programs being supported;
- (3) such financial assistance will materially further the purposes of this part; and
- (4) the applicant is fulfilling or will fulfill a need for services, supplies, or facilities which is otherwise not being met.
